排序
一对多关系中的分页查询和过滤:如何高效解决JOIN和第一范式冲突?
业务关系为一对多的分页查询与多侧条件过滤 在业务系统中,经常会遇到一对多的关系,并且需要分页查询和根据多侧条件进行过滤的需求。针对这种情况,需要设计合理的数据库表结构和查询方案来高...
laravel支持几种数据库
Laravel 支持多种数据库连接,包括:MySQL、PostgreSQL、SQLite、SQL Server、MariaDB、MongoDB 和 Redis。要连接到数据库,您需要在 .env 文件中设置配置并使用 DB 外观进行连接。 Laravel 支...
Mysql常用基准测试工具
mysqlslap 常用参数说明 –auto-generate-sql 由系统自动生成sql脚本进行测试 –auto-generate-sql-add-autoincrement 在生成的表中增加自增ID –auto-generate-sql-load-type 指定测试中使...
navicat怎么写sql
sql是操作数据库中数据的语句,在不同的数据库中会略有不同。Navicat for MySQL是一款很方便的MySQL客户端工具,能够很好的提供操作数据库可视界面,在同类型的软件中,占有极高的市场份额。为...
SQL 中 having 的用法?
SQL 中 having 的用法? “having”是“group by”之后进行统计的筛选,一般“having”会和“group by”一起使用,使用时要先“group by”进行分组,然后再进行“having”统计筛选,例如判断聚...
right join是什么意思
right join是sql语言中的查询类型,即连接查询,全称为右外连接,是外连接的一种。right join关键字从右表返回所有的行,即使左表中没有匹配。如果左表中没有匹配,则结果为NULL。 right join是...
oracle数据库的存储过程是什么?
oracle数据库的存储过程:一组为了完成特定功能的SQL语句集,经编译后存储在数据库中。存储过程是由流控制和SQL语句书写的过程,这个过程经编译和优化后存储在数据库服务器中,应用程序使用时只...
PhpStorm是什么软件?
phpstorm 是 jetbrains 公司开发的一款商业的 php 集成开发工具,旨在提高用户效率,可深刻理解用户的编码,提供智能代码补全,快速导航以及即时错误检查。 PhpStorm 是一个基于 JetBrains ...
控制台实时查看 sql
listen-sql 一个在控制台看到实时 sql 操作的工具 在 Laravel 中打印 sql,以往的做法往往是,通过 DB::listen 监听,然后通过 Log::info 写入到 log 中。 这样写入的 log,我们想查看往往是去 ...
ThinkPHP数据库操作之连接数据库
下面由thinkphp教程栏目给大家介绍thinkphp数据库操作之连接数据库 ,希望对需要的朋友有所帮助! ThinkPHP内置了抽象数据库访问层,把不同的数据库操作封装起来,我们只需要使用公共的Db类进...
如何在 SQL 中使用变量引发错误
阅读更多: https://codetocareer.blogspot.com/2024/11/how-to-use-variables-in-sql-raiserror.html SQL RAISERROR 语句用于在 SQL Server 中生成自定义错误消息。通过将变量与 RAISERROR 结...
nginx 502 Bad Gateway错误怎么解决
nginx 502的触发条件 502错误最通常的出现情况就是后端主机当机。在upstream配置里有这么一项配置:proxy_next_upstream,这个配置指定了 nginx在从一个后端主机取数据遇到何种错误时会转到下一...